T84.418A
ICD-10-CMBreakdown (mechanical) of other internal orthopedic devices, implants and grafts, initial encounter
This code signifies a mechanical failure or malfunction of an internal orthopedic device, implant, or graft, excluding joint prostheses, internal fixation devices, or other specifically classified devices. This breakdown is due to a structural issue with the device itself, rather than an infection, displacement, or other complication.
Use this code when a patient presents with symptoms directly attributable to a mechanical failure of an internal orthopedic device, such as a spinal fusion cage, bone graft substitute, or a non-joint implant. This applies to the initial assessment and treatment of the device failure.
